PT: Booking enrolment interviews

Jan 23, 2018

When parents are wanting to book an enrolment interview we will typically use the ‘Parents meet pre-selected staff’ option, however the parent still has to enter their child’s name and year level.  The problem comes when they are entering a year level – do they enter the current year level or the year level they are going into?  Often parents are not sure which to choose and many end up choosing the wrong option.  This is confounded because SOBS requires you to select valid year levels for which the round will be applicable.

The Enrolment year level

To resolve this issue we have created a new year level called ‘Enrolment’ that will appear as the first year level in the list of year levels available within SOBS.  To use this option the SOBS Administrator can enable this year level as a year level valid at the school – you can do this in the School Settings page, the valid year levels are at the bottom of the page.

Once selected as valid you can then configure your enrolment interview round as normal, and select the ‘Enrolment’ year level as the valid year level for this round.  When parents access the system to book their interview they will add the new child’s name and the ‘Enrolment’ year level will be selected by default – this is then reasonably clear that the correct option is selected.  When the parent saves the child details the Enrolment interview round will then appear as required.

Adding an Enrolment year to your configuration

Schools that joined SOBS after August 2013 will automatically have the ‘Enrolment’ year level as a selectable option.  Schools that joined prior to August 2013 won’t have this, however it is easy to add, just follow these instructions:

  1. Go to your School Settings page, the first tab should be displayed automatically
  2. Click the ‘Edit’ button to edit these details
  3. At the bottom of the form you will find a list of year levels that are available to your school – these will differ depending on when you first joined SOBS
If you are not using (and unlikely to use) the first entry in the year level list then follow these instructions:
  1. Type over this first year level name and specify ‘Enrolment’ or any alternative text you would like
  2. Check the box below this year level to indicate you will be using it
  3. Click ‘Save’
  4. You will now be able to use this option on your enrolment interview round
If you are using (or are likely to use) the first entry in the year level list then follow these instructions (NOTE: You should not use this procedure if you are currently operating the School Notices application):
  1. If you are using the earlier options in this list then it is likely you will not be using the last few, so we need to shuffle the list to the right
  2. For example if there are 14 entries then move the 13th description to the 14th description area and similarly adjust the checkbox value
  3. Repeat this moving from the right to the left, ie next move the 12th description to the 13th description area and similarly adjust the checkbox value
  4. Repeat this all the way to the 1st entry moving to the 2nd entry area
  5. Lastly you will enter into the 1st description area the text ‘Enrolment’ or any alternative text you would like
  6. Check the box below this year level to indicate you will be using it
  7. Click ‘Save’
  8. Now this will cause issues for the current students registered – they will now not reflect the correct year level, so we need to adjust the student year levels
  9. In the Parent/Teacher interview booking application click the ‘Parents’ link in the main menu
  10. As the SOBS Administrator you will see a ‘Make global changes’ button at the top of the page – click this button
  11. One of the first options is to ‘Increment all student year levels’ – click this button (just once)
  12. Your students should all now have the correct year level and you will also be able to use the ‘Enrolment’ option for your enrolment interview round
